Understanding Vacuum Cast Coil Dry Type Transformers

Vacuum cast coil dry type transformers are advanced electrical devices designed to provide efficient power distribution in various applications. Unlike conventional transformers, these units utilize a unique vacuum casting process that enhances their durability and performance. The coils are encapsulated in a resin, which not only protects them from moisture but also improves their thermal management, making them ideal for environments with strict fire safety regulations. One of the key advantages of vacuum cast coil transformers is their fireproof characteristics. The materials used in their construction are non-combustible, significantly reducing the risk of fire hazards. This feature makes them particularly suitable for installations in high-risk areas, such as industrial plants, data centers, and commercial buildings where safety is a paramount concern.

Manufacturing Process of Vacuum Cast Coil Transformers

The manufacturing process of vacuum cast coil dry type transformers involves several critical steps that ensure high quality and reliability. Initially, the winding process creates the coils, which are then placed in a vacuum chamber. In this chamber, resin is introduced under vacuum conditions, thoroughly impregnating the coils. This process eliminates air pockets, ensuring maximum insulation and heat dissipation. Once the casting is complete, the transformers undergo rigorous testing to ensure they meet industry standards and specifications. This includes electrical testing, thermal cycling, and fire resistance tests, confirming that the transformers can withstand operational stresses and environmental challenges. Vacuum cast coil dry type transformers find applications across various sectors, including commercial, industrial, and renewable energy markets. Their robust design and fireproof nature make them an excellent choice for locations where space is limited and safety is a top priority. They are commonly used in substations, wind farms, and solar energy installations. The benefits of using vacuum cast coil transformers extend beyond safety. These transformers are highly efficient, resulting in lower energy losses during operation. Furthermore, their maintenance-free nature and resistance to environmental factors contribute to reduced operational costs over time.
